India: Infant dies as slips into hospital toilet at Hallet Hospital

Kanpur: In a bizarre incident an infant slipped into the hole of the commode of Lala Lajpat Rai Hospital here on Friday.

The doctors at the hospital apparently refused to admit a pregnant woman, Haseen Bano, 30, when she came to the emergency ward.

Her husband Moin pleaded with the doctors as his wife went into labour.

When the pain became unbearable, the woman went to the toilet, where she delivered the baby, but the infant slipped and the head got stuck in the hole of the seat.

Although the hospital staff plunged into action and broke the commode seat but the infant had died by then.

Though Dr Sanjay Kala, Principal, Ganesh Shankar Vidyarthi Memorial Medical College has ordered a probe following forming a committee. It will be apt to know that the Lala Lajpat Hospital is connected with the College.

"The issue is serious. A committee has been constituted to investigate the entire matter. Strict action will definitely be taken against the guilty," said Dr Kala.
